Updating

Tell us your dates, and we will find the most accurate rates and availability for you

Updating

Apartments in Midlothian with tennis nearby | Holiday Lettings

All filters (1)

Filters (1)

Clear filters

3 Holiday homes

Applied filters (1)

Danderhall holiday home rental

Danderhall house

  • 3 bedrooms
  • 1 bathroom
  • sleeps 6

from £481 / night

£687 - £1,135 / week

1 / 19

Holiday manor house with golf nearby in Dalkeith

Dalkeith manor house

  • 5 bedrooms
  • 6 bathrooms
  • sleeps 10

from £1,374 / night

£9,155 / week

1 / 35

Holiday apartment in Newington

Newington apartment

  • 5 bedrooms
  • 2 bathrooms
  • sleeps 9

“Great time at Epicurean Clerk” Just one word..AMAZING!!!!the flat is huge and as perfect as in the pictures. we had an amazing graduation weekend in the flat and looking forward to come again next time. We felt home!

from £287 / night

£1,334 - £1,495 / week

1 / 14

Great rentals within 20 miles that match your search

Haddington holiday cottage rental

Haddington cottage

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£247 / night

£974 / week

1 / 17

Apartment rental in Kinghorn with golf nearby

Kinghorn ap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 5

from £144 / night

£916 / week

1 / 15

Edinburgh holiday apartment rental

Edinburgh ap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

from £1,718 / night

£11,450 / week

1 / 8

Cottage rental in Bathgate

Bathgate cottage

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£90 / night

£630 - £974 / week

1 / 14

Holiday barn rental

Drem barn

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£85 / night

£490 - £715 / week

1 / 13

Holiday apartment rental

Davidsons Mains ap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£132 / night

£784 - £1,049 / week

1 / 23

Apartment rental in Peebles with golf nearby

Peebles ap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

from £121 / night

£842 - £945 / week

1 / 17

Galashiels holiday barn rental

Galashiels barn

  • 4 bedrooms
  • 3 bathrooms
  • sleeps 8

from £288 / night

£1,432 - £2,569 / week

1 / 26

Galashiels holiday barn rental

Galashiels barn

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 8

from £288 / night

£1,432 - £2,569 / week

1 / 31

Edinburgh holiday apartment rental

Edinburgh ap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 3

from £109 / night

£687 - £928 / week

1 / 19

Innerleithen holiday cottage rental

Innerleithen cottage

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 6

from £166 / night

£1,163 / week

1 / 36

Holiday apartment with golf nearby in Cramond

Cramond ap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£264 / night

£1,661 - £2,004 / week

1 / 25

Holiday apartment with golf nearby in Musselburgh

Musselburgh ap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£92 / night

£642 / week

1 / 28

Holiday apartment in Edinburgh

Edinburgh ap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£201 / night

£1,403 / week

1 / 36

Kinghorn holiday apartment rental

Kinghorn ap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£149 / night

£974 - £1,374 / week

1 / 18

Holiday castle in North Berwick

North Berwick castle

  • 7 bedrooms
  • 7 bathrooms
  • sleeps 13

from £2,290 / night

£16,030 - £20,839 / week

1 / 16

Holiday home with golf nearby in Innerleithen

Innerleithen house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£126 / night

£687 - £1,072 / week

1 / 19

Apartment rental in New Town with golf nearby

New Town ap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 5

from £382 / night

£2,672 / week

1 / 38

Holiday apartment with golf nearby in Marchmont

Marchmont ap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£310 / night

£2,004 / week

1 / 25

Home rental in Gullane with golf nearby

Gullane house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£447 / night

£2,004 - £2,119 / week

1 / 16

Apartment rental in Gifford with golf nearby

Gifford ap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£75 / night

£521 / week

1 / 21

Innerleithen holiday apartment rental

Innerleithen apartment

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 10

from £567 / night

£2,428 / week

1 / 81

Holiday apartment in Edinburgh

Edinburgh ap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

from £1,144 / night

£8,007 / week

1 / 9

Holiday apartment in Edinburgh

Edinburgh ap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£1,144 / night

£8,007 / week

1 / 10

Holiday home in Edinburgh

Edinburgh house

  • 3 bedrooms
  • 1 bathroom
  • sleeps 10

from £1,144 / night

£8,007 / week

1 / 10

Holiday apartment in Edinburgh

Edinburgh ap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£149 / night

£1,042 / week

1 / 18

Holiday home with golf nearby in Lauder

Lauder house

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£86 / night

£544 / week

1 / 15

Holiday apartment in Edinburgh

Edinburgh ap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 4

from £229 / night

£1,145 / week

1 / 8

Apartment rental in Edinburgh with golf nearby

Edinburgh apartment

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

from £320 / night

£1,828 - £3,656 / week

1 / 27

Holiday apartment in Edinburgh

Edinburgh ap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£86 / night

£573 - £813 / week

1 / 18

Apartment rental in Quartermile

Quartermile ap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£286 / night

£1,718 / week

1 / 28

Holiday apartment in Old Town, Edinburgh

Old Town, Edinburgh apartment

  • 2 bedrooms
  • 2 bathrooms
  • sleeps 6

from £630 / night

£4,409 / week

1 / 13

Holiday home with golf nearby in Innerleithen

Innerleithen house

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£90 / night

£561 / week

1 / 24

Apartment rental in Edinburgh with golf nearby

Edinburgh ap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£149 / night

£1,042 / week

1 / 24

Apartment rental in Kirkcaldy

Kirkcaldy apartment

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£109 / night

£665 - £905 / week

1 / 33

Holiday apartment in Edinburgh

Edinburgh apartment

  • 4 bedrooms
  • 2 bathrooms
  • sleeps 10

from £344 / night

£1,718 / week

1 / 22

Holiday apartment with golf nearby in Peebles

Peebles ap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£86 / night

£384 - £567 / week

1 / 27

×

Also consider